Stargate comes to an end

Posted on August 22, 2006 | Post a comment |

The Sci-Fi Channel in the US has confirmed that it's finally putting Stargate out of its misery and won't be renewing the series for yet another season. Stargate: Atlantis will continue, however.

Updates and related entries

August 23, 2006: Stargate SG-1 may have been cancelled, but producer Robert C Cooper has vowed to keep the programme going somehow.
September 1, 2006: Stargate SG-1's producers are looking for another network for the show.
October 12, 2006: Stargate will return as DVD movies.
